A Professional Letter of Resignation is a formal notice announcing an employees intent to leave their job. These letters are brief but courteous and are usually hand-delivered to supervisory staff or human resources. How to Resign Professionally Quitting a job can be an uncomfortable enterprise, but using a few of the following thoughtful steps can help to ease any difficulty and may aid in keeping relations in good standing. Be Aware of Company Policies: Standard practice is to provide companies with 2 weeks notice. But before you announce your departure, check to see if there are any preferred policies concerning employment termination. Have a Direct Conversation: Its best to speak directly with your employer about your intent to leave and to use a resignation letter as a supporting document. A toxic workplace has overwhelming negative factors that affect the well-being of those within it. A toxic work environment can manifest through discriminatory practices, harassment, lack of respect among colleagues, poor communication, excessive workload, lack of teamwork and overbearing office politics.
As soon as youre notified of a resignation, contact payroll and IT to begin offboarding procedures. In addition, have the employee sign any necessary paperwork, such as a resignation letter or a noncompete or nondisclosure agreement, and notify the individual of benefits end dates and any COBRA considerations.
